pub struct SocketBufferSizes {
pub send: Option<SocketBufferSizeRange>,
pub receive: Option<SocketBufferSizeRange>,
/* private fields */
}
Expand description
Settings for socket buffer sizes.
Fields§
§send: Option<SocketBufferSizeRange>
Send buffer sizes settings.
receive: Option<SocketBufferSizeRange>
Receive buffer sizes settings.
